What does it mean to walk in the truth?
Walking in the truth means living the teachings of Jesus on a daily basis. It means showing love to others by being kind, generous and forgiving, living a life that reflects your faith, speaking words of blessing and encouragement to those around you, and speaking out against injustice when you see it. It also means taking time each day to deepen your relationship with God through prayer, Scripture reading and worship. By dedicating ourselves to following these principles, we can become more like Jesus every day, walking in His light and reflecting His glory on this earth.

The benefits of walking in truth
When we choose to live out Jesus' teachings on a daily basis, we reap a number of benefits. We learn to forgive those who have wronged us, to serve others without expecting anything in return, to be patient with difficult people, to resist temptation, to trust God even when life doesn't make sense, and so much more. Ultimately, walking in the truth brings us closer to God, and brings us closer together as a community of believers, and helps us all grow spiritually.
